A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

本帖最后由 闪电侠 于 2015-7-13 00:04 编辑

我发现OC的Foundation 框架中有很多类型从来没见过,但是看头文件,发现其实就是C语言中的一些基本数据类型,被typedef了一个别名而已。。
那么这么做是为了什么呢???

比如:
  1. typedef unsigned char                   Boolean;

  2. typedef unsigned long                   NSUInteger;

  3. typedef int                  NSInteger;

复制代码



1 个回复

正序浏览
给原来的类型起一个别名,更容易理解啊!就像一个词语在不同的语境有不同的意思一样,不同的名称方便记忆.
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马